The final itself was already complicated by large absence on both sides. Barcelona’s Robert Lewandowskitheir leaderexcluded with a thigh injury and forced Xavi to turn to Ferran Torres as a compensation in the attack. On Madrid’s side, the absence of Mbappe was criticized from start XI to an unknown tactical decision.
Carlo Ancelotti chose to field a Two-man attack with Vinicius junior and rodrygoreinforced by an extra midfielder in Dani Ceballos to solidify the middle of the pitch.
As Kickoff approached, there was little clarity. Mbappe had competed against time to regain fitness after Spraining its right ankle under Madrid’s Champions League -Quart Loss to Arsenal. During the days leading up to the final, Ancelotti suggested on Mbappe’s accessibility but remained vague. “He could be available,” Ancelotti said mid week and added to forward “Was to do everything to be ready to help the team.” But when it mattered, he did not consider himself suitable enough to start.

It wasn’t until after the match that Carlo Ancelotti finally lifted the veil. Italian with reporters explained the Italian his choice to bench the French superstar: “He wasn’t up to play 90 minutes, and I preferred to have him during the second half when the game’s rhythm loses a bit, ”The Italian boss revealed. “He played well and scored a goal.”
Mbappe’s fitness problemIn combination with the estimated need for fresh firepower later in the game, Ancelotti’s decision ran. The plan was to release him when Barcelona’s energy was flagged – a game that almost paid off.

Adding more drama to the night, Rodry’s catastrophic first half Made Ancelotti’s half -time decision inevitably. The Brazilian wing was completely ineffective, with critics describing his performance as “sadly” and “Null”.
The Brazilian bad show got Ancelotti to turn to Mbappe earlier than perhaps originally intended. The Frenchman entered half time to replace Rodrygo and immediately injected pace, danger and hope in Madrid’s sluggish attack.

Mbappe’s Heroics almost turns the tide
Although they carry the remains of an ankle damage, Mbappe changed the momentum of the match. In the 70th minute, he served and converted a free kick to smooth the points at 1-1 and gnawed noise from Madrid Trofast. Minutes later, Madrid even seized a 2-1 leadApparently on the verge of securing the Copa trophy.
However, Barcelona, led by Ferran Torres and a definite midfield, gatheredequalizing late to force extra time. During the added period, Madrid’s tired legs could not match Barcelona’s fresher reserves, and the Catalans dressed a 3-2 victory – Their third Clasico -Shager over Madrid this season. In the meantime, Mbappe had given everything he had, but his fitness restrictions became clear when the match was on.
